We are pleased about your interest in a position in the St. Gallen judiciary. The courts of the canton of St. Gallen make over 15,000 decisions each year in various areas of law. The court staff work daily on behalf of those seeking justice for an independent and efficient judiciary and thus make a valuable contribution to legal peace.
The District Court of St. Gallen is the court of first instance in civil and criminal matters. Depending on jurisdiction, a single judge or the court in a panel of three or five judges decides. The District Court employs around 45 staff members.
